The transcript discusses the essential elements of a great Star Trek episode, emphasizing high concepts, character dynamics, and deeper themes like the fear of the unknown. It highlights the episode 'Devil in the Dark' as an example of exploring these themes. The speaker also shares inspiration from director Nicholas Meyer, expressing confidence in understanding and replicating his directing style.
